A lighting distribution box is designed specifically to manage and distribute power to multiple lighting circuits. It typically includes in-line terminals, multiple cable entry points, and mounting options for easy installation and compliance with wiring regulations ( ). These boxes can accommodate various conductor sizes, such as 3 x 2.5mm², 2 x 4mm², or 1 x 6mm², and often feature expansion options to add extra outlets if needed. They are used in both hard-wired 230V systems and centralized lighting control systems, including DALI or other smart lighting networks ( ). The design ensures safe, organized, and flexible distribution of power to lighting fixtures.
A wiring box, also known as a junction box, is a general-purpose enclosure used to connect, protect, and organize electrical wires. It provides a safe space for splicing wires, installing terminals, or connecting switches and outlets. Wiring boxes are essential for preventing electrical hazards, maintaining circuit integrity, and complying with safety standards. They can be installed in walls, ceilings, or floors and are available in various materials and protection ratings depending on the environment ( ).

Both boxes must comply with relevant standards such as IEC 61439, IEC 60670, and local electrical codes. Proper selection ensures adequate space, heat dissipation, and protection against moisture or mechanical damage ( ). In summary, while a lighting distribution box focuses on distributing power to lighting circuits efficiently and safely, a wiring box serves as a general-purpose enclosure for connecting and protecting electrical wires. Both are essential for safe, organized, and code-compliant electrical installations.
